I only wore a big, puffy winter jacket once in November, and it was on this day when it felt pretty cold and winter-like. And because I had to wear this jacket to stay warm, I didn't put too much effort into my outfit since it wouldn't be seen much.

I like white jackets because they match everything, and white is a nice winter color, but they can get dirty pretty easily. I also like longer jackets because "normal length" ones feel too short to me. Plus, I often wear long cardigans that I don't want peeking out of my jacket.
